Description
The Brevard Police Department is seeking a motivated and service-oriented Part-Time Safety Assistant to provide administrative, operational, and community support services. This position performs a variety of non-sworn duties that enhance public safety operations, support police personnel, assist crime victims, and strengthen community engagement efforts.
The Safety Assistant serves as a visible representative of the Police Department and may assist with special events, school crossing operations, records management, victim follow-up contacts, customer service functions, and various administrative duties. This position is ideal for individuals interested in public service, criminal justice, victim advocacy, or community engagement.
Actual duties and assignments may vary based on departmental needs and employee availability.
Schedule: This is a part-time, variable-hour position. Hours are not fixed and will vary depending on operational needs, seasonal demand, and specific assignments. This position does not guarantee a set number of hours per week or a consistent schedule.
Examples of Duties
The following duties are representative of the position and are not intended to be all-inclusive:
Community and Public Safety Support
  • Serve as a crossing guard at designated school crossings to promote pedestrian safety and traffic flow.
  • Assist with traffic control operations and road closures during special events and community activities.
  • Staff the Police Department event post during festivals, parades, and other public events.
  • Serve as a Downtown Ambassador by providing directions, assistance, and customer service to residents and visitors.
  • Observe and report public safety concerns to on-duty police personnel.
Criminal Investigations and Victim Services Support
  • Conduct follow-up contacts with crime victims as directed by Criminal Investigations Division personnel.
  • Provide victims with information regarding available resources, services, and case status updates when appropriate.
  • Assist with victim satisfaction surveys and community outreach efforts.
  • Support investigators with administrative tasks, case organization, and records management functions.
Administrative and Records Support
  • Assist with front desk operations, including greeting visitors and answering telephones.
  • Provide administrative support to police personnel and department divisions.
  • Assist with records management, data entry, filing, document preparation, and report organization.
  • Maintain departmental files and assist with document retention procedures.
  • Assist with preparing reports, correspondence, spreadsheets, and other administrative documents.
Special Events and Community Engagement
  • Assist with planning, coordinating, and participating in community events and public safety programs.
  • Support department initiatives such as National Night Out, Special Olympics events, community safety programs, youth outreach activities, and other special projects.
  • Represent the department in a professional and positive manner during public interactions.
Other Duties
  • Assist with various operational, administrative, and community-service functions as assigned.
  • Perform related duties as required to support the mission of the Brevard Police Department.
Qualifications
  • High school diploma or GED required.
  • Strong customer service and interpersonal communication skills.
  • Ability to maintain confidentiality and exercise sound judgment.
  • Ability to work independently with minimal supervision.
  • Experience in public service, customer service, administrative support, records management, criminal justice, victim services, or related fields is preferred.
  • Possession of a valid North Carolina driver's license or ability to obtain one within a reasonable timeframe.
Physical Requirements
  • Ability to stand, walk, and remain outdoors for extended periods during assigned duties.
  • Ability to perform light to moderate physical activity, including walking, lifting, carrying, bending, reaching, and directing traffic.
  • Ability to operate a motor vehicle when required.
  • Ability to work in varying weather conditions, including heat, cold, rain, and other outdoor environments.
Working Conditions
Work is performed in both office and outdoor settings. Duties may require frequent interaction with the public, exposure to varying weather conditions, and attendance at evening or weekend events. Employees must demonstrate professionalism, tact, sound judgment, and a commitment to exceptional customer service at all times.
